Can I get admission in BITS, Pilani if I qualify BITSAT exam but fail to score 75% in class 12th with PCM?

Marks eligibility criteria at BITS is as follows: "The candidate should have obtained a minimum of aggregate 75% marks in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ics subjects (if he/she has taken Mathematics in BITSAT) or a minimum of aggregate 75% marks in Physics, Chemistry and Biology subjects (if he/she has taken Biology in BITSAT) in 12th class examination, with at least 60% marks in each of the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ics / Biology subjects". Therefore if you do not get 75% marks in PCM you will not be eligible for seeking admission in any of BITS University colleges.

Is there any criteria for direct admission in BITS Pilani on the basis of class 12th marks?

BITS has provision for direct entry for toppers of different board of examination 10+2. Eligibility criteria is as follows:
"To be eligible for admission under the 'Direct admission to Board toppers' scheme, the candidate should be the topper from the science stream having taken physics, chemistry, mathematics subjects in 12th. To identify the topper, the following criteria is adopted.
The topper is the student who fulfills the following criteria:
a) has taken physics, chemistry, and mathematics subjects in 12th class examination and
b) has obtained the highest aggregate percentage of marks in 12th class among all the students who have taken physics, chemistry, and mathematics subjects in 2016 from the board. For the purpose of calculating, the aggregate percentage, the aggregate marks should include the marks of physics, chemistry, and mathematics subjects in addition to other subjects which are required to pass the 12th class examination from the board under consideration. Further, the physics, chemistry, mathematics subject marks should be included in the aggregate, irrespective of whether the physics, chemistry, and mathematics subjects are identified as main/ optional/ elective in his mark sheet(s)".
